
Ontario parents received a gift of a lifetime from their daughter, who unknowingly blessed them with a major lottery prize.
Mississauga residents Carlos and Francisca Fuentes are rejoicing after winning a Lotto 6/49 second prize worth $57,924.90 in the June 25 draw.
The married parents of four and grandparents of eight enjoy playing the lottery as a team. Carlos has been a loyal lottery player since the days of Wintario, while Francisca occasionally picks up a ticket.

“Our daughter gave us this ticket as a gift,” they shared with the Ontario Lottery and Gaming Corporation. That lucky ticket led them to their first big win.
“We were on our way to an appointment when we scanned our ticket using the OLG app,” recalled the duo while visiting the OLG Prize Centre in Toronto to collect their winnings.
“At first, we thought we’d won $57. When we realized it was more than $57,000, excitement filled the car. We were so shocked and couldn’t believe it. We didn’t tell anyone until we could confirm it for sure.”
Carlos and Francisca went to a store to double-check their lottery ticket using the ticket checker.
“Once we knew the win was real, we shared the news with our close family. The kids couldn’t believe it,” they said, smiling. “They were thrilled for us both.”
The couple have fun plans for their lottery windfall. They want to treat themselves to a trip to Italy next year.
“We’ll also be helping out our grandkids with some of their finances as they prepare for university,” they added.
When asked what it’s like to win the lottery, the couple said, “It feels very good. We feel so happy and blessed to have won this prize.”
Carlos and Francisca’s daughter bought the winning lottery ticket at Esso/Circle K on Highway 27 in Vaughan.
